Overcoming Bad Credit: Accessing Secured Home Loans
Navigating the homeownership journey with challenging credit can seem daunting. Yet, several options exist to help you achieve your dream of owning a residence. One such path is exploring private home loans, specifically designed to assist borrowers with scoring difficulties. These loans often involve less strict underwriting criteria, evaluating factors beyond your credit score.
- Private lenders may prioritize your income, assets, and debt-to-income ratio providing more personalized terms.
- Investigate various private lenders carefully to find one that aligns with your requirements.
- Be prepared to demonstrate strong financial stability through documentation such as bank statements and tax returns.
Remember that while private loans can be a viable solution, they often come with greater fees. Carefully review the loan terms and assess offers from multiple lenders to ensure you make the best possible deal.

Unlocking Homeownership: Private Mortgage Options
Purchasing a home is often considered the cornerstone of financial stability and personal success. However, the traditional mortgage landscape can be daunting, with stringent requirements and limited flexibility. For individuals who may not meet conventional financing, private mortgage options offer an alternative path to ownership. Private lenders often have more relaxed underwriting guidelines, making them a viable solution for first-time buyers, self-employed individuals, or those with less-than-perfect credit. These private loans can come in various forms, including hard money loans, portfolio loans, and bridge loans, each catering to specific financial situations.
When considering a private mortgage, it's crucial to thoroughly research the lender. Look for a reputable lender with experience in private lending and a proven track record of customer satisfaction. Review loan terms carefully, including interest rates, fees, and repayment schedules.
